My ds is tiny - only 22lbs and 32 inches at 24 months old. He has a 12 inch torso. I have heard you all talk about how short the slots on the comfort sport are, so I decided to try him in it just to see. I was shocked that his shoulders seemed to be at the top slots. I also tried him in the new evenflo titan that goes up to 50lbs. He is slightly under the top slots. My ds probably wouldn't get past 25lbs in that seat. Just for comparison, IF (the seats I tried at target were in the ff position) ds was ff he would be in the second to top slots in the scenera, He would have lots and lots of room in the triumph advance, and lots of room in the graco cargo. He still fits in a safeseat 1!
Don't worry - he is not ff and won't be for quite some time.
